How to Find the Elusive Sand Dollar on Anna Maria Island.

tl;dr Anna Maria Island is great for shell collectors, especially for finding sand dollars. Best spots to find sand dollars: Bean Point, Bradenton Beach, Coquina Beach, and Anna Maria City Beach. Tips for finding sand dollars: Know your tide chart – sand dollars are often found near the mean low water line. Look for ro...

Holmes Beach Public Basketball Court

Anna Maria Island has one public basketball court located in Holmes Beach.  The basketball court is located across from the tennis courts just at the end of 62nd street just East of Island Real Estate.  It is a full basketball court fenced in so errand balls will remain in play.  I have used the court several times a...
